Dataset Card for GENIA Term Corpus
The identification of linguistic expressions referring to entities of interest in molecular biology such as proteins, genes and cells is a fundamental task in biomolecular text mining. The GENIA technical term annotation covers the identification of physical biological entities as well as other important terms. The corpus annotation covers the full 1,999 abstracts of the primary GENIA corpus.
